ARIZONA Reservoirs near record lows PAGE — The Colorado River’s Lake Powell, the second largest reservoir in the U.S., is shrinking. A record-dry winter and extreme heat — as well as decades of overuse, chronic drought and climate change — are threatening to pummel the lake to near historic lows. Low water levels have forced…
